Description/Notes: PRIMARY PURPOSE:



Responsible for managing treasury, accounting and accounts payable functions. This includes assisting with budget preparation, financial analysis, financial reporting, developing and implementing effective systems of accounting, accounts payable functions and maintaining financial records.



QUALIFICATIONS:



Education/Certification:

Bachelor Degree in Accounting or business related field, with minimum of 24 hours in accounting

Masters degree and TASBO (RTSBA) preferred



Special Knowledge/Skills:

Proficiency in financial analysis

Proficiency in computer data entry, including working knowledge of spreadsheet and word processing

Demonstrated skills in accounting, financial reporting, budgeting and accounting software programs

Excellent organizational, communication and interpersonal skills



Minimum Experience:

Five years’ related experience in public accounting or school district accounting preferred



MAJOR RESPONSIBILITIES AND DUTIES



Fiscal Management

Keep the chief financial officer informed on the business affairs of the District
Evaluate accounting procedures, systems, and controls in all district departments and recommend improvements in their design, implementation and maintenance
Oversee and maintain district capital asset records and accounting entries as needed
Evaluate and maintain the accounting procedures manual for the district
Maintain a continuous auditing program for all funds and assist the district’s independent auditors in conducting the annual audit
Develop and maintain period cash flow analysis to aid in determining cash available for investment and payment of bills
Maintain the District investment portfolio
Oversee preparation of monthly bank reconciliations for all district depository accounts, review reconciliations of vendor and payroll clearing accounts
Prepare and/or review all general ledger account reconciliations monthly to include all funds
Prepare and/or review all budget adjustments, additions, and deletions
Assist in the preparation of the district budget
Administer the business office budget and ensure that programs are cost effective and funds are managed prudently
Plan and conduct needs assessments for improvement of district business operations. Ensure that business operations support the district’s goals and objectives and provide leadership to achieve cost-effective practices throughout the district.
Work with directors, principals and other school employees, assist with accounting and financial issues as requested
Prepare and evaluate monthly financial statements and related budget reports
Develop professional skills appropriate to job assignment
Perform other duties as assigned
Policy, Reports, and Law

Keep informed of and comply with all federal, state, and district policies and regulations concerning public education business administration and implementing new GASB standards.
Compile, maintain, and file all physical and computerized reports, records, and other documents required
Prepare in conjunction with external auditor comprehensive annual financial report in compliance with Association of School Business Officer (ASBO) and Government Finance Officers Association (GFOA) standards
Develop and review periodic, as required, financial information for submission of data to TEA
Review and approve periodic, as applicable, reports for all federal or state grant funds
Personnel Management

Develop training options and/or improvement plans to ensure exemplary business operations, including determining staff development needs
Train, supervise, and evaluate personnel and make sound recommendations relative to personnel placement, assignments, retention, discipline, and dismissal
Provide positive reinforcement of district culture and work relationships
District Relations

Demonstrate active participation in business office management
Demonstrate management practices that promote collegiality, teamwork, and collaborative decision making among members of the staff and leadership team
Community Relations

Articulate the District’s mission to the community and solicit its support in realizing the mission
Participate in activities that help build community support of the schools
Attend board meetings
SUPERVISORY RESPONSIBILITIES:



Supervise and evaluate the performance of accounting and accounts payable department.
